On December 1, 2022, the Korea-Israel FTA and the Korea-Cambodia FTA entered into force. An overview of each FTA is provided below.
I. Overview
A. Korea-Israel FTA
Israel has sought FTAs with Asian countries to diversify its current trade structure, which is concentrated in the Americas and Europe. Her FTA this time is meaningful in that Korea is the first Asian country to conclude her FTA with Israel.
Tariffs on major export items to Israel such as automobiles, auto parts and synthetic resins will be eliminated immediately, and tariffs on most traded items will be eliminated within 10 years. Based on import volume, Israel’s tariff elimination level is 100%, while South Korea agrees with her high elimination rate of 99.9%.
In particular, as Korea’s first FTA to introduce a ‘technical cooperation’ chapter in the agreement, cooperation between the two countries is expected to expand to industries such as big data, information technology (IT), and biotechnology (BT) in the future. will be ), renewable energy, aerospace.
B. Korea-Cambodia FTA
Korea and Cambodia are parties to two existing trade agreements, the Korea-ASEAN FTA and RCEP. The South Korea-Cambodia FTA will also open up free trade at 0.8% of all items and 19.8% of total imports.
The Korea-Cambodia FTA eliminates tariffs on export items excluded from the Korea-ASEAN FTA and RCEP. In particular, tariffs on knitted goods (Cambodia 7%) and garments (Korea 5%) will be eliminated, strengthening the value chain of trade related to textile and apparel manufacturing.

II. BKL Insight A. Korea-Israel FTA Korea’s main export items to Israel include automobiles, synthetic resins, and imaging equipment. In terms of imports, South Korea imports industrial electronic products from Israel, such as semiconductor manufacturing equipment, electronic application equipment, measurement control analysis equipment, and wireless communication equipment. The effect of the FTA with Israel is expected to further promote trade in these industries.

In addition, the fusion of Israel’s cutting-edge technology and South Korea’s manufacturing technology will increase exports of automobile parts, home appliances, textiles, secondary batteries, etc., and new investment is expected.
B. Korea-Cambodia FTA
As of 2020, South Korea’s main exports to Cambodia are beverages, knitted goods, and trucks, while its main imports are clothing and shoes. is expected, and direct investment in Cambodia in the apparel industry is expected to be further strengthened.

C. Rules of Origin
To take advantage of FTAs signed by South Korea, preferential tariffs for South Korea (for imports) and the exporting country (for exports) and the exact HS code for each item under review.
In addition, even when preferential tariff rates are applied under an FTA, the importing country or exporting country may request the submission of relevant documents, so it is important for importers and exporters to keep relevant documents for five years.
Rules of origin and their verification processes and methods are highly complex and require expertise in FTAs and local legislation. Therefore, we recommend that you seek professional advice before proceeding with any import or export transaction under an FTA.
